Excessive Shock or Engine Revs Up Abnormally High on All Upshifts and Downshifts (A/T)




Excessive shock or engine revs up abnormally high on all upshifts and downshifts

A/T clutch pressure control solenoid valve B defective

A/T clutch pressure control solenoid valve C defective

Input shaft (mainshaft) speed sensor defective

Output shaft (countershaft) speed sensor defective

ATF temperature sensor defective

Foreign material in separator plate orifice
